Sigma Aldrich Sigma Aldrich
Sigma Aldrich - 388718 external link
Application
Hydrophobic material is derivatized to make detergents and anti-rust additives. Adds tack, flexibility and water repellency to adhesives and coatings. Contributes ′cling′ to LLDPE films. Plasticizer for polymers, lubricants and metal-working fluids.
Features and Benefits
Tackiness increases with molecular weight. Some internal double bonds may be present.
Other Notes
remainder 1- and 2-butenes
Physical form
Terminal vinyl group.
